大胆 (dàdǎn) meaning in English
dǎn

大胆 means 'bold' or 'courageous,' describing someone who acts with confidence and without fear. It emphasizes the quality of taking risks or making decisions despite potential dangers or uncertainties.

The character 大 (dà) means 'big' or 'great,' and 胆 (dǎn) refers to 'gall bladder' or 'courage.' Together, they form a metaphorical expression meaning 'to have big gall,' which translates to having the courage to act boldly.

大胆 is commonly used in both formal and informal contexts, such as in business, politics, or personal life. It can be used to praise someone for their bravery or to encourage others to take initiative. In Chinese culture, being bold is often seen as a positive trait, especially when it involves standing up for one's beliefs or making important decisions.

💬 Example Sentences

他大胆地提出了一个新想法,得到了大家的认可。
dàdǎn
He boldly proposed a new idea, which was recognized by everyone.
她大胆地辞职,开始了自己的创业之路。
dàdǎn
She boldly quit her job and started her own business.
